Outline Sybe 10 is a very light, normal width, low contrast, upright, normal x-height font.

A serif outline design with a single, consistent contour defining each glyph, producing an airy, hollow interior. The letterforms follow classical proportions with bracketed serifs, moderate curves, and steady stroke shaping, while the outline maintains even spacing and clean corners. Capitals are stately and evenly proportioned; lowercase forms read traditionally with clear bowls and arms, and the numerals follow old-style-inspired proportions with open, rounded counters. Overall spacing and rhythm feel measured, with outlines that stay legible at display sizes and create a neat, engraved-like edge.

Works well for headlines, titles, and short passages where the outline effect can be appreciated—such as posters, book covers, magazine mastheads, packaging, and formal invitations. It can also serve as a secondary display face paired with a solid text serif to add hierarchy and visual texture.

The outlined construction lends a delicate, ceremonial feel, while the underlying serif structure adds a sense of tradition and authority. It suggests editorial polish and a lightly ornamental, vintage-leaning tone without becoming overly decorative.

The design appears intended to capture the familiarity of a traditional serif while adding an outline treatment for a lighter, more decorative presence. It balances readable, conventional skeletons with a distinctive contour-only rendering suited to display typography.

Because the strokes are defined by contours rather than filled mass, the design reads best when given enough size or contrast against the background. In continuous text, the interior openness can make color appear lighter and more spacious than a solid serif.
